Micah Richards will not be available for Aston Villa at
Tottenham after being handed a one-match ban by the
Football Association.
Aston Villa defender Micah Richards will miss Monday's Premier
League game with Tottenham after being handed a one-match
ban by the Football Association (FA).
Richards was given the suspension and a £10,000 fine following
his admission of an improper conduct charge relating to an
altercation in the tunnel at the game against Swansea City on
October 24.
The former Manchester City player had previously clashed with
Swansea's Federico Fernandez on the pitch during the first half
of the match at Villa Park, with Fernandez seen pushing his
head towards his opponent.
Neither player received a misconduct charge for that incident,
however, Richards will now be unavailable as Villa aim to
impress new manager Remi Garde - who is expected to be
watching from the stands - against Tottenham. at White Hart
Lane.
Villa are bottom of the Premier League with just four points
from 10 games.
